Bamboo offers a more sustainable alternative to conventional raw materials like cotton and timber. However, it's crucial to understand that many textiles marketed as bamboo are actually made from viscose rayon, which undergoes a chemical process that strips away the natural qualities of bamboo fibers, leading to possible misrepresentation. According to the Federal Trade Commission (FTC), any yarn that doesn't use pure bamboo fiber must be labeled as "rayon" or "rayon made from bamboo," emphasizing the need for accurate labeling in textiles. Moreover, bamboo is one of the fastest-growing plants, making it a renewable resource.

What Is Viscose from Bamboo?
Viscose from bamboo refers to a type of regenerated cellulose fiber crafted from bamboo plant pulp. As a textile, it is a manufactured fiber derived from plant cellulose, specifically bamboo, and is used in clothing, bedding, and sustainable fashion. While bamboo is a natural source, the resulting bamboo viscose is classified as a manufactured fiber due to the extensive chemical processing it undergoes.
The bamboo viscose manufacturing process begins with harvesting bamboo shoots, cutting them into pieces, and soaking them in a solution. This involves using sodium hydroxide to dissolve the cellulose in the bamboo, creating a pulpy mass. This pulp is then spun into regenerated cellulose fibers. This process can occur in a closed-loop system, allowing solvent recycling and minimizing environmental harm. However, artificial fertilizers may sometimes be used in bamboo cultivation, impacting overall sustainability. The pulpy mass is extruded through spinnerets to create fibers, which are subsequently woven or knitted into textiles. Similar methods are used to produce other manufactured fibers from wood pulp and cellulose.
It's important to understand that while bamboo is a natural source, bamboo viscose is a manufactured fiber due to the chemical processes involved in its production.

Bamboo Viscose
Bamboo viscose is the most prevalent form of bamboo fabric available. It is created through a chemical process that dissolves bamboo pulp and regenerates it into fibers. Most textiles marketed as bamboo are actually produced from viscose rayon, which undergoes the same chemical transformation that diminishes bamboo's natural fiber characteristics, leading to potential misunderstandings. Per the FTC, unless yarn is made from pure bamboo fiber, it must be labeled as "rayon" or "rayon made from bamboo" to ensure transparency.
Bamboo Linen
In my work with sustainable textiles, bamboo linen represents a significant advancement in mechanical fiber processing. Unlike traditional bamboo viscose production, bamboo linen retains the inherent structure of bamboo fibers through mechanical extraction methods. This processing results in a fabric known for its durability, unique texture, and strong environmental performance. For professionals focused on genuine sustainability in their products, bamboo linen offers unparalleled natural qualities.

How Is Bamboo Viscose Produced?
The production generally involves several key stages:
- Harvesting Bamboo: Raw bamboo shoots are collected and chopped into pieces.
- Creating Pulp: The bamboo pieces are mechanically crushed.
- Dissolving the Pulp: The crushed bamboo is immersed in a chemical solution, typically sodium hydroxide, to dissolve the cellulose and form a pulpy substance.
- Forming Fibers: The pulpy mass is extruded through spinnerets to produce regenerated cellulose fibers.
- Creating Yarn: The resulting fibers are spun into bamboo yarn.
- Weaving or Knitting: The yarn is turned into fabric.
This method yields a fabric that is remarkably soft, smooth, and lightweight, making it ideal for garments worn against the skin, ranking it among the softest fabrics used in clothing and bedding.
The bamboo viscose production can be conducted in a closed-loop system, allowing solvent recycling to reduce environmental impact. However, there are concerns regarding the safety and environmental effects of chemical emissions, such as carbon disulfide, energy consumption, and overall process sustainability.

Viscose from Bamboo Compared to Cotton
Here's a comparison of bamboo viscose fabric and cotton fabrics:
Feature | Bamboo Viscose | Cotton |
|---|---|---|
Softness | Smoother and silkier, becomes softer with each wash | Soft, but typically less silky |
Moisture Control | Superior absorption and evaporation | Good, but less effective than bamboo |
Breathability | Highly breathable, often feels cooler | Breathable, but can feel warmer |
Sustainability | Bamboo grows faster, uses less water, but viscose process can be polluting | Organic cotton is eco-friendly, but conventional cotton uses more water and can lead to soil erosion |

The production process can harm the environment through hazardous wastewater leaks. While bamboo itself is renewable, the viscose conversion process is often harmful. The chemical-intensive production requires harsh substances such as carbon disulfide and sodium hydroxide, which can pollute local waterways if not managed in a closed-loop system. Bamboo plantations can sequester up to 62 tonnes of carbon dioxide per hectare annually, significantly surpassing young forests, marking bamboo as a valuable crop for carbon capture and oxygen generation, particularly when compared with other breathable, eco-conscious fibers like lyocell.
The FTC has penalized several major retailers for mislabeling textiles made of viscose rayon as 'bamboo', highlighting serious labeling issues in the industry. Many textiles marketed as bamboo are actually derived from viscose rayon, produced through a chemical process that diminishes the natural qualities of bamboo fibers, leading to potential misunderstandings. Numerous companies combine bamboo with other materials, and the bamboo content in these blends can vary, making it essential for consumers to scrutinize labels to know what they are purchasing.

Certifications and Safety
Certifications to Seek
When exploring the bamboo fabric market, industry professionals recognize the importance of certifications and safety standards to ensure the acquisition of high-quality, responsibly made products. Experienced buyers look for certifications such as Oeko-Tex 100, known for guaranteeing rigorous testing for harmful substances and adherence to strict safety standards within the industry. Labels like "made from bamboo" or "bamboo viscose" are crucial indicators that validate the fabric's genuine origin from bamboo fibers, a skill that seasoned professionals develop through extensive market knowledge.
Safety Considerations in Manufacturing
The viscose process used to create bamboo viscose presents manufacturing challenges that can involve toxic chemicals like carbon disulfide, a reality that experienced professionals navigate with care. To address environmental and health concerns, industry experts suggest looking for manufacturers skilled in using non-toxic solvents and operating closed-loop systems, representing advanced practices for recycling chemicals and minimizing waste. Care and Maintenance
Washing Bamboo Viscose
Professional textile care specialists have established protocols for maintaining bamboo fabric items at their best throughout their lifespan, following expert viscose cleaning and washing guides. Bamboo textiles, including premium bamboo bedding and garments, require specific machine washing methods utilizing gentle cycles and pH-balanced, mild detergents. Industry experts consistently advise against chlorine bleach and harsh chemical treatments, as extensive research has shown these substances can compromise fiber integrity and reduce the fabric's inherent softness.
Drying and Ironing
Advanced textile preservation techniques recommend low-temperature drying or air-drying methods to keep the fabric's smooth surface intact while preventing dimensional instability. For ironing, professional standards stress using low-temperature settings to protect the delicate bamboo fiber structure from heat damage.
Best Practices for Longevity
Industry best practices developed over years of textile experience underscore processing bamboo fabrics in separate wash loads from other fiber types to prevent pilling and minimize the risk of viscose shrinkage during washing.
